Not all roofing products are developed equivalent. Some whisper tales of durability, others boast environment-friendly virtues, while a couple of stand as monuments to aesthetic appeal. Here's a fast rundown of the most prevalent types:
Is it purely about toughness, or does style tip the scales? Often, the choice feels like choosing a preferred kid-- each product provides distinct advantages. Roofing contractors typically weigh aspects such as:
Material | Resilience | Expense Range | Setup Problem | Ecological Effect |
---|---|---|---|---|
Asphalt Shingles | 15-30 years | Low | Easy | Moderate |
Metal Roof | 40-70 years | Medium | Moderate | High (recyclable) |
Clay Tiles | 50-100 years | High | Difficult | Low |
Wood Shingles | 20-40 years | Medium | Moderate | Moderate |
Slate | 75-200 years | High | Extremely Difficult | Low |

On one vigorous fall early morning, a coworker underestimated a weak area concealed beneath old shingles. The resulting fall was a stark lesson: never trust what looks strong without a comprehensive check. Ever given that, a "tap test" with the hammer before positioning weight has actually been my routine, exposing hidden rot or damage unnoticeable to the eye.
Gear | Function | Expert Pointer |
---|---|---|
Full-body Harness | Fall arrest and avoidance | Double-check buckles and webbing for wear before each use |
Roofing Boots | Slip resistance and foot protection | Select boots with aggressive tread and water resistance |
Tough Hat | Head impact defense | Change after any considerable effect, even if no damage shows up |
Gloves | Grip and hand protection | Opt for gloves with strengthened palms and flexibility |

Ever wondered why some roofing systems endure the rage of storms while others fail? The response lies deep in the mastery of roofing methods and the tools wielded by knowledgeable roofing contractors. Take, for instance, the art of shingle positioning. It's not practically laying shingles in neat rows; it's about understanding the subtle play of wind, rain, and sun exposure. Misaligned shingles can welcome leaks, which typically sneak in undetected until the damage is permanent.
When it concerns tools, a roofing professional's toolbox is a treasure chest of precision instruments. The simple roof hammer isn't just for pounding nails-- it's designed with a magnetic nail holder that speeds up deal with high slopes, keeping safety and performance in consistency. And after that there's the chalk line tool, an easy string that marks perfectly straight lines. Without it, even the most knowledgeable roofer might struggle to keep balance across a sprawling surface.

Tool | Function | Pro Suggestion |
---|---|---|
Roofing Hatchet | Driving nails, cutting shingles | Utilize the hammer side to tap carefully to prevent breaking shingles |
Energy Knife | Cutting roofing products | Modification blades often to ensure clean cuts |
Air Nailer | Rapid and consistent nailing | Check air pressure routinely to avoid over-penetration |
